In this game, it can be seen in the first half that the team is quite confident in ball-playing, even though the number of shots are lacking.

However the confidence level somehow dropped (i guess?) in the second half, where HC took most possession while we defend like crazy until Tomori help to give us bit of a cushion sweat.gif

For the goals conceded, imo it was a weird mistake from Kova when he turned his body while jumping during HC’s freekick being taken, causing a deflection sufficient enough to confuse Willy.


Few points to note,

Alonso was somewhat good in this game. Good up until the point he gave away the freekick that lead to HC’s goal.

Pedro on the other hand was just plain bad (except for his pace. Dude got stamina yo). Guess his time is finally up.

CHO performed like the old days. Except maybe he needs to practice his finishing touches. With a little bit more practicing and experiences gained, he could be our own ‘Sancho’ imo.

All in all, it can be said that the team still struggle in killing games off. Lamps might need to instil this to the team, i.e. try to kill the game in the first half lol laugh.gif

Anyway, just enjoy the win. Hopefully it boosts the team morale to face tougher fixtures ahead. For now, we advance to the next round of the FA cup!

Speaking about haaland and seeing how he's living up to the hype, do u guys think we made a mistake in not just going for him? Yea I know raiola's a douchebag for insisting on that get out clause for his client, and any team who takes up the offer is practically open to losing the star striker when barca/madrid/bayern come knocking, but is it really that big a deal?

Are we basically admitting yea the team's going to hell in a couple of years when someone decides to activate the clause and turns his head..are we really that bad? Looking back down the years, many teams have lost their star players and survived just fine.

Arsenal lost henry to barca, utd lost ronaldo to madrid, pool lost suarez/coutinho to barca, spurs lost bale to madrid, and we've lost the likes of drogs and lamps, as they aged,etc. Too soon to tell how much we'll miss eden (though I'm well aware we could've used him in a couple of our games this season), but my point is nobody stays forever and perhaps that dreaded clause has been blown out of proportion.

In the end what matters most is the results we can achieve with the players we have NOW, and not worry excessively about what happens in the future. Besides, we can always convince him (or any other player for that matter) that stamford bridge is his home, and there's no need to go anywhere else. Or some other club turns his head and we lose him anyway, clause or no clause! Bottom line is, the club perseveres and moves on.

Dortmund were smart in moving swiftly with a firm bid imo, while other clubs were busy worrying about how the clause will affect them in the future. In the end they get to enjoy a top class player who'll ultimately help in their league and CL ambitions,while we're stuck with only one good striker who's showing little signs of improvement, due to the lack of competition.
